How the natural world and the man-made world interact

Nature and man-made world are in constantinteraction. The natural world has a wonderful quality: it can develop and recover, and the man-made world can only destroy. A natural nature can live without human intervention, and a man without nature will never live.

man-made world

Realizing this, a man was constantly fighting withnature. The result of this struggle is lamentable: thousands of animals and plants have been destroyed, a very important document has appeared - the Red Book, which lists very rare specimens of flora and fauna that people can not meet with people

The man-made world increasingly displaces nature. Modern people are so far from nature that they rarely contact with it, and children learn about hares and bells from TV sets.

Mankind constantly produces garbage, polluting everything on the planet: the surface of the earth, the ocean expanses and airspace. It got to the point that there was a problem of clogging up space!

It is important to remember that balance in the wild is ideal.And she does not need help, she can provide for herself. And interference in nature very often brings unexpected results. When in Australia they started planting thorny fences, they did not expect that these "thorns" would be so tenacious and would fill all the loose surfaces.

People constantly tried to "improve"nature: drained swamps, turned rivers back, built dams. After many years it became clear that the natural resources were used illiterately, they must be protected and respected by nature.
